Badger women end long losing skid

February 9, 2016 By Bill Scott

Michala Johnson

Michala Johnson

The Wisconsin women’s basketball team ended their seven-game losing streak, knocking off the Purdue Boilermakers 64-57.

Michala Johnson had 19 points and 13 rebounds as the Badgers pulled the big upset at the Kohl Center.

The Badgers (7-15, 3-9 Big Ten) took the lead against the Boilermakers (16-7, 7-5) for good at 33-30 when Roichelle Marble banked in a three-pointer with 33 seconds left in the first half.  The Badgers held off Purdue from that point moving forward.

Prior to Monday night, the Badgers last win in the Big Ten came back on January 10, a 82-62 win over Penn State.
